1. What is a count and match worksheet?
A count and match worksheet is an educational activity designed to help young learners practice their counting skills by matching a group of objects to the correct numeral. This type of worksheet reinforces fundamental math concepts for kindergarteners.
- Children first count the objects (like apples or stars) in each section.
- They then identify and find the corresponding number from a given set of options.
- Finally, they draw a line to connect the group of objects to its correct number, which also helps develop fine motor skills.

3. What skills are built by this Kindergarten Maths Count Match to Ten activity?
This worksheet is a fun math activity for preschoolers that helps develop several crucial early numeracy and pre-writing skills. It provides a solid foundation for more advanced math concepts.
- Counting Skills: Practice counting objects sequentially from 1 to 10.
- Number Recognition: Helps children identify and differentiate between numerals 1-10.
- One-to-One Correspondence: Teaches the concept that each object corresponds to one number.
- Fine Motor Skills: Drawing lines to match objects and numbers strengthens hand-eye coordination and pre-writing abilities.
- Visual Learning: Using images makes the process of learning numbers engaging and memorable.
4. How do you teach counting to a kindergarten student with this worksheet?
To teach counting effectively to a kindergartener using this worksheet, focus on making the experience interactive and hands-on. This home learning resource makes it easy for parents and teachers to guide children.
- Start by pointing to each object in a group and counting aloud together. This demonstrates one-to-one correspondence.
- After counting, ask your child, "How many are there?" to reinforce the total.
- Then, ask them to find that number on the other side of the page.
- Encourage them to trace the number with their finger before drawing a line to it, enhancing numeral identification.

8. How does this worksheet help with number recognition?
This worksheet directly supports number recognition by requiring children to actively link a quantity of objects to its written numeral. This repeated matching process helps solidify the visual form of each number in a child's memory.
- After counting a group of items, the child must scan a list of numerals to find the correct one.
- This task of identifying the right number among others (e.g., finding '7' from a choice of '5', '7', '9') reinforces their ability to distinguish between different numerals.
